UMLを学ぶための教材の基本情報・価格・レビュー。
PR・広告を含みます対象講座なら受講料の最大80%(給付区分・上限・要件あり)が後日戻り、実質負担を抑えられます。独学の本+スクールの併用も。
▶ あなたの講座でいくら戻るか試算(無料・30秒)
はじめての方へ:教育訓練給付のしくみと損しない選び方 / 申請手順5ステップ
学んだ後に「作って公開する」ための環境例です。サーバー・ツールは教育訓練給付/補助の対象外です。
※給付率・実質額は区分(一般20%/特定一般40%/専門実践 最大80%)と要件で変わり、即時値引きでなく後日支給です。最終可否はハローワーク・厚労省でご確認ください。掲載はPR(送客手数料を受領)。
「オブジェクト指向による情報システムの設計第2版」はムイスリ出版が発行するUML向けの教材です(2011年02月)。独学で学ぶ方の教材選びの参考に。
UML(Unified Modeling Language)は、ソフトウェアや業務システムの構造・振る舞いを図で共有するための標準化された表現法です。要件、設計、実装の各段階で同じ図法を使えるため、仕様を関係者で同じ見方にそろえやすくなります。
こんな人向け:想定読者は、プログラミングや情報システムの基礎があり、要件や設計を図で整理したい人です。図を読む際に、記号の意味より先に“何を伝えるための図か”を考える姿勢があると学びが速く進みます。
学習は、UMLの全体像を掴むことから始め、次に主要図の読み取りを身につけ、実務課題で使える形に落とし込む順が有効です。最初から全部を網羅するより、目的に応じて図を選ぶ判断力を育てる順番が、定着と運用の両面で安定します。
独学では「記号の記憶より目的の明確化」が先です。最初から高度な図を追うより、短い題材で図と文章を往復し、読める・説明できる状態にする教材を選ぶと定着しやすいです。独習のポイントは、図を1冊で消費するのではなく、作成→説明→修正という往復を重ねる学習設計です。
独学で進みが不安な場合や、期間内に確実に進めたい場合は、基礎→演習→添削や確認がセットになった体系的な学習選択が有効です。同じテーマを段階的に反復し、理解不足を早期に潰せる流れが選択の目安になります。 ▶ 給付でいくら戻るか試算
Q. UMLはプログラミング言語の代わりになる?
UMLは実装そのものを記述する言語ではありません。設計意図や仕様の共有を支援する可視化の仕組みとして使うのが本来の使われ方です。図とコードは代替ではなく、相互参照で価値が高まります。
Q. 最初に全部の図を覚える必要はある?
全部をいきなり扱う必要はありません。実務で頻出する図から使い始め、目的に合った図に絞るほうが学習効率が高いです。目的が明確になるにつれて必要な図は自然に増えていきます。
Q. 独学でつまずいたらどこから見直す?
図の難しさより、題材の選び方が原因になることが多いです。要件が曖昧なまま進めると理解が散らばるため、まずは短い仕様を1つ決めて図を起こす練習に戻ると戻りやすいです。疑問は「この図で何を表したいか」を起点にすると解像度が上がります。
次の一冊:次は、業務要件定義と基本設計の考え方、またはソフトウェア開発の開発プロセスとレビュー実務の解説カテゴリに進むと理解が連続します。あわせて、チームでの設計ドキュメント運用や品質の視点に進むと、UMLの効果を実務で判断しやすくなります。